Curve 76230cx2

76230 = 2 · 32 · 5 · 7 · 112



Data for elliptic curve 76230cx2

Field Data Notes
Atkin-Lehner 2- 3+ 5+ 7- 11+ Signs for the Atkin-Lehner involutions
Class 76230cx Isogeny class
Conductor 76230 Conductor
∏ cp 24 Product of Tamagawa factors cp
Δ 30821770903770 = 2 · 39 · 5 · 76 · 113 Discriminant
Eigenvalues 2- 3+ 5+ 7- 11+  2  4  4 Hecke eigenvalues for primes up to 20
Equation [1,-1,1,-13718,-554309] [a1,a2,a3,a4,a6]
Generators [1174:5485:8] Generators of the group modulo torsion
j 10896752313/1176490 j-invariant
L 11.064931726256 L(r)(E,1)/r!
Ω 0.44422961600908 Real period
R 4.1513560130451 Regulator
r 1 Rank of the group of rational points
S 1.0000000000636 (Analytic) order of Ш
t 2 Number of elements in the torsion subgroup
Twists 76230m2 76230a2 Quadratic twists by: -3 -11
